Analysis

Macau, China recorded 0.9229 current US$ per US$ of GDP for exports of goods and services (current us$), per unit of gdp in 2025.

The figure is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 17.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, exports of goods and services (current us$), per unit of gdp in Macau, China peaked at 1.14 current US$ per US$ of GDP in 1984 and was at its lowest, 0.6166 current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2020.

That places Macau, China 12th out of 193 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 44 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Exports of goods and services (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Exports of goods and services (current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
